THE ACTUAL DANCE, LLC has announced Samuel A. Simon's THE ACTUAL DANCE, directed by Kate Holland. THE ACTUAL DANCE will play a limited engagement at the Studio Theatre (Theatre Row, 410 West 42nd Street). Performances are Saturday, January 10th at 2:00 pm through Sunday, February 1st at 3:00 pm. Tickets are $26.25 and available at theatrerow.org.

An award-winning play, The Actual Dance is a beautiful love story--a graceful and inspiring journey through the uncharted waters of illness, where the resilience and power of the human heart ultimately perseveres.

When first noticing his wife at the age of sixteen, Sam could not predict the profound connection they would share-they are two halves of the same whole. In their 33rd year of marriage, that love was tested...and the ringing in Sam's ear was not as one would expect, in fact it was an orchestra, playing the music of his life--The Actual Dance.

The show will feature live music composed and arranged by Music Director Eli Zoller, whose experience as a Music Director and professional musician extends from Broadway to regional theaters and univiersities across the country. The original music is arranged for guitar and cello.

The production features movement direction by Marine Sialelli, dramaturgy by Gabrielle Maisels, assisant stage manager is Esti Bernstein and Justin Cornell is the stage manager.
